Skip to content

Commit

Permalink
Merge branch 'main' into docs/add-blog-recap-community-days
Browse files Browse the repository at this point in the history
  • Loading branch information
stephanbcbauer authored Dec 16, 2024
2 parents 0c6f6fb + 2e8b1d6 commit 693b10d
Show file tree
Hide file tree
Showing 5 changed files with 81 additions and 51 deletions.
34 changes: 34 additions & 0 deletions blog/2024-12-16-kit-icons-update.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,34 @@
---
title: Unified Design and Color Scheme for Kit Icons
description: Unified Design and Color Scheme for All Kit Icons
slug: unified-design-color-kits
date: 2024-12-16
hide_table_of_contents: false
authors:
- name: Thibault Grandemenge
title: Business Domanin Manager
url: https://github.com/Grand-Thibault
image_url: https://github.com/Grand-Thibault.png
email: [email protected]
---

![KITs landscape](@site/static/img/kits/KIT_landscape.drawio.svg)

Hello Tractus-X community,

We are excited to announce a major update to the design of our KIT icons! We have implemented a new, unified design and color scheme that improves consistency, readability, and visual cohesion across all KITs. With this update, all icons now follow a standardized layout that visually connects them while still allowing room for individuality. The new layout enhances the overall user experience and ensures a more polished look in the gallery and beyond.

## A Unified Layout for a Unified Experience

Color plays a critical role in differentiating KITs and making them visually accessible. To achieve this, we have updated the color scheme to strike a balance between shared identity and unique representation:

- KITs within the same domain now share a common base color to symbolize their connection,
- Each KIT retains its own accent color to emphasize its unique scope.

This ensures that each kit is still easily identifiable while reinforcing its association with the broader domain. We have also adjusted the primary color for certain kits to improve readability and contrast. These changes are particularly noticeable in the KIT gallery, where some older color choices made text and icons harder to read.

## Why These Changes Matter

Consistency and clarity are key to making our open source project accessible and enjoyable for everyone. By unifying the design and refining the color scheme, we’re making navigation easier, improving accessibility and creating a cohesive identity.

All color codes can he found [here](https://github.com/eclipse-tractusx/eclipse-tractusx.github.io/blob/main/static/img/kits/kit-colors.md).
85 changes: 34 additions & 51 deletions blog/2025-02-19-release-planning-R25.06.mdx
Original file line number Diff line number Diff line change
Expand Up @@ -18,54 +18,48 @@ import RenderImage from './RenderImage'

Hello, Eclipse Tractus-X Community!

We are thrilled to invite you to a series of important sessions designed to drive collaboration, alignment, and planning for Eclipse Tractus-X Release R25.06.
These meetings are essential to ensure a well-structured and successful release. Mark your calendars and come prepared to contribute!
Collaboration drives the success of Eclipse Tractus-X, and we are excited to invite you to the **Release Planning sessions for R25.06**! These sessions are your chance to shape the roadmap, align with the community, and ensure a well-structured release.

The overall teams session link and more links can be found on our [open-meetings](https://eclipse-tractusx.github.io/community/open-meetings#one-time-meetings) page.
**Key Information:**
- 📅 **Dates and Times**: Listed for each session below.
- 📂 **Resources**: Visit our [**open meetings page**](https://eclipse-tractusx.github.io/community/open-meetings#one-time-meetings) for all session links and additional documentation.
- 🔗 **Preparation Materials**: Ensure readiness by reviewing the provided templates, guidelines and your own features.

We look forward to seeing you all there!!!
We look forward to seeing you there and working together to make R25.06 a success!

<!--truncate-->

## Refinement Day 1 for R25.06

During the refinement sessions, each group will focus on the first steps of skeleton-building for their features ( based on the [feature template](https://github.com/eclipse-tractusx/sig-release/issues/new?assignees=&labels=&projects=&template=1_feature_template.md) ),
mapping them to the related roadmap items. Don’t worry about completing every section of the feature template just yet this is a time for brainstorming and forming initial ideas.

It's essential, however, to use the **feature template** and identify **dependencies** with other components or groups, which will help us add the correct labels to the features.
You’re encouraged to collaborate across groups as needed, and we’ll provide **Teams sessions** for each group to work in.
The first Refinement Day sets the foundation for R25.06. Expert groups will brainstorm, refine features, and identify key dependencies for roadmap alignment.

- **Date:** Wednesday, 22nd January 2025
- **Time:** 09:05 - 12:00
- **Main Teams Link:** [Join the session](https://teams.microsoft.com/l/meetup-join/19%3ameeting_ODVmYWM1OGYtNjdkYS00ODgxLWI1YWEtMjAwZGJjY2NjNGIw%40thread.v2/0?context=%7b%22Tid%22%3a%221ad22c6d-2f08-4f05-a0ba-e17f6ce88380%22%2c%22Oid%22%3a%22a8b7a5ee-66ff-4695-afa2-08f893d8aaf6%22%7d)

### Agenda

Here’s the plan for the day:
- **09:05 - 09:30**: Welcome, Introduction, and Expectations
- **09:30 - 11:15**: Refinement in dedicated groups, grouped by expert groups
- **11:15 - 11:45**: Presenting the results, grouped by expert groups
- **09:30 - 11:15**: Refinement in dedicated groups
- **11:15 - 11:45**: Group presentations on progress
- **11:45 - 12:00**: Closing and Next Steps

### Preparation Checklist

- Review the [feature template](https://github.com/eclipse-tractusx/sig-release/issues/new?assignees=&labels=&projects=&template=1_feature_template.md).
- Prepare initial ideas for features.
- Identify potential dependencies with other groups or components.
- Familiarize yourself with related roadmap items.
- Use the supported-by field to map the feature with your expert group

### Group and Teams Sessions

During the refinement sessions, each group will focus on the first steps of skeleton-building for their features (based on the [feature template](https://github.com/eclipse-tractusx/sig-release/issues/new?assignees=&labels=&projects=&template=1_feature_template.md),
mapping them to the related roadmap items. Don’t worry about completing every section of the feature template just yet this is a time for brainstorming and forming initial ideas.

It's essential, however, to use the **feature template** and identify **dependencies** with other components or groups, which will help us add the correct labels to the features.
You’re encouraged to collaborate across groups as needed, and we’ll provide **Teams sessions** for each group to work in.

### Group Work & Presenting Results

The goal of the refinement is to **identify the first ideas and dependencies** within your group. The **General Teams session** will be available for any questions that come up during this collaborative work.

Important for the session:
- Use the [feature template](https://github.com/eclipse-tractusx/sig-release/issues/new?assignees=&labels=&projects=&template=1_feature_template.md) to structure your work
- Identify dependencies with other components or groups and add the correct labels to the features
- Use the supported-by field to map the feature with your expert group

At the end of the refinement session, we’ll regroup and present the progress made. Each expert group will present their refined features, focusing on what’s been developed so far and the key insights.

### Group and Teams Sessions

:::tip
The sessions for the different groups / components / dependencies can be used to sync within the underlying expert groups. Feel free to switch between groups if necessary!
:::
Expand All @@ -76,27 +70,28 @@ The sessions for the different groups / components / dependencies can be used to

## Refinement Day 2 for R25.06

During the refinement sessions, each group will focus on resolving **identified dependencies** from Refinement Day 1, which are visible via the **related labels** on the features.
While further feature refinement is allowed, the emphasis is on addressing and coordinating **dependencies** between groups and components.

Our working Board for the day is the [Release Planning - R25.06 - Preparation](https://github.com/orgs/eclipse-tractusx/projects/26/views/36)

You’re encouraged to collaborate across groups as needed, and we’ll provide **Teams sessions** (we will use the same sessions from Refinement Day 1) for each group to work in.
It might be the case for some experts to jump into different other groups to resolve dependencies.
The second Refinement Day focuses on resolving **dependencies** identified during Refinement Day 1. Groups will refine their features further, ensuring alignment across components.

- **Date:** Wednesday, 12th February 2025
- **Time:** 09:05 - 12:00
- **Main Teams Link:** [Join the session](https://teams.microsoft.com/l/meetup-join/19%3ameeting_MWVjNTkwNTEtYTFiZS00ODI5LWE4MTgtMzE5MWM2ZGIwMzgw%40thread.v2/0?context=%7b%22Tid%22%3a%221ad22c6d-2f08-4f05-a0ba-e17f6ce88380%22%2c%22Oid%22%3a%22a8b7a5ee-66ff-4695-afa2-08f893d8aaf6%22%7d)

### Agenda

Here’s the plan for the day:
- **09:05 - 09:30**: Welcome, Introduction, and Expectations
- **09:30 - 11:15**: Refinement in dedicated groups, grouped by expert groups
- **11:15 - 11:45**: Presenting the results, grouped by expert groups
- **09:05 - 09:30**: Welcome and recap of Refinement Day 1 results
- **09:30 - 11:15**: Group work on resolving dependencies
- **11:15 - 11:45**: Group presentations on resolved dependencies
- **11:45 - 12:00**: Closing and Next Steps

### Group Work & Presenting Results
### Key Focus Areas

- Use the [feature template](https://github.com/eclipse-tractusx/sig-release/issues/new?assignees=&labels=&projects=&template=1_feature_template.md).
- Add labels for identified dependencies.
- Collaborate across groups to resolve issues.
- Use the supported-by field to map the feature with your expert group.
- Status `Backlog`-> this should be an alignment, between the requesting Expert Group/Committee and the open-source community.

### Group and Teams Sessions

During the refinement sessions, each group will focus on resolving **identified dependencies** from Refinement Day 1, which are visible via the **related labels** on the features.
While further feature refinement is allowed, the emphasis is on addressing and coordinating **dependencies** between groups and components.
Expand All @@ -106,20 +101,6 @@ Our working Board for the day is the [Release Planning - R25.06 - Preparation](h
You’re encouraged to collaborate across groups as needed, and we’ll provide **Teams sessions** (we will use the same sessions from Refinement Day 1) for each group to work in.
It might be the case for some experts to jump into different other groups to resolve dependencies.

Important for the session:
- Use the [feature template](https://github.com/eclipse-tractusx/sig-release/issues/new?assignees=&labels=&projects=&template=1_feature_template.md) to structure your work
- Identify dependencies with other components or groups and add the correct labels to the features
- Use the supported-by field to map the feature with your expert group
- help each other to solve/analyze dependencies

At the end of the refinement session, we’ll regroup and present the progress made. Each expert group will present their refined features, focusing on what’s been developed so far and the key insights.

:::note
If the feature is ready refined, the status should be set to `Backlog`-> this should be an alignment, between the requesting Expert Group/Committee and the open-source community.
:::

### Group and Teams Sessions

:::tip
The sessions for the different groups / components / dependencies can be used to sync within the underlying expert groups. Feel free to switch between groups if necessary!
:::
Expand All @@ -130,6 +111,8 @@ The sessions for the different groups / components / dependencies can be used to

## Open Planning for R25.06

The Open Planning session finalizes the roadmap for R25.06, prioritizing features and aligning all participants on deliverables for the release.

- **Date:** Wednesday, 19th February 2025
- **Time:** 09:05 - 17:00
- **Teams Link:** [Join the session](https://teams.microsoft.com/l/meetup-join/19%3ameeting_NGRkMWIxOTctYTg3ZC00MWExLTk5NjYtMjBjZjYzYWFmZDMx%40thread.v2/0?context=%7b%22Tid%22%3a%221ad22c6d-2f08-4f05-a0ba-e17f6ce88380%22%2c%22Oid%22%3a%22a8b7a5ee-66ff-4695-afa2-08f893d8aaf6%22%7d)
Expand Down
4 changes: 4 additions & 0 deletions static/img/kits/KIT_landscape.drawio.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
5 changes: 5 additions & 0 deletions static/img/kits/KIT_landscape.drawio.svg.license
Original file line number Diff line number Diff line change
@@ -0,0 +1,5 @@
This work is licensed under the CC-BY-4.0

- SPDX-License-Identifier: CC-BY-4.0
- SPDX-FileCopyrightText: 2024 Contributors to the Eclipse Foundation
- Source URL: https://github.com/eclipse-tractusx/eclipse-tractusx.github.io/blob/main/static/img/kits/KIT_landscape.drawio.svg
4 changes: 4 additions & 0 deletions utils/newsTitles.js
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,10 @@ export const newsTitles = [
date: "16.12.2024",
title: "Third Eclipse Tractus-X Community Days Recap",
blogLink: "/blog/community-days-recap-12-2024"
},
date: "16.12.2024",
title: "Unified Design and Color Scheme for Kit Icons",
blogLink: "/blog/unified-design-color-kits"
},
{
date: "19.02.2025",
Expand Down

0 comments on commit 693b10d

Please sign in to comment.